Crispy Parmesan Potatoes Recipe

Ingredients

  • ~1.5 lb / ~700 g baby potatoes (e.g. Yukon Gold) (Yay! For Food)
  • 3–4 tbsp olive oil (Dishing Delish)
  • ½ cup (or more) freshly grated Parmesan cheese (Hungry Huy)
  • 1 tsp garlic powder (or 3–4 garlic cloves, minced) (Dishing Delish)
  • ½ tsp onion powder (optional) (Dishing Delish)
  • ½ tsp dried thyme or oregano (optional) (Hungry Huy)
  • Salt & black pepper to taste (Dishing Delish)
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ish) (Jo Cooks)

Instructions

  1. Prep
    •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). (Hungry Huy)
    • Wash the potatoes. If they’re big, cut into bite‑sized pieces; if small (baby), you can halve them. (Dishing Delish)
    • (Optional) Soak the cut potatoes in water for ~15 minutes to remove some starch, then dry them thoroughly. (Dishing Delish)
  2. Season
    • In a large bowl, toss the potatoes with olive oil, garlic powder (or minced garlic), onion powder (if using), thyme or oregano, salt, and pepper. (Dishing Delish)
    • Add about half of the Parmesan and mix so that the cheese sticks to the potatoes. (The Fig Jar)
  3. Bake
    • Spread the potatoes in a single layer on a baking sheet. Don’t overcrowd them — they crisp better when they have space. (Jo Cooks)
    • Roast for about 25–30 minutes, flipping once partway (around 15 mins) so both sides crisp. (Dishing Delish)
    • After they’re nicely browned, sprinkle the remaining Parmesan on top and roast for another ~5 minutes (or until the cheese melts and browns). (Cup of Yum)
  4. Finish & Serve
    • Once out of the oven, let them rest for a minute or two so the cheese can firm up. (Hungry Huy)
    • Garnish with fresh parsley. (Jo Cooks)
    • Serve immediately for the best crispy texture.

Tips / Variations

  • Scored Potatoes Version: Instead of halving, you can score each potato (diagonal shallow cuts) so the Parmesan paste seeps in and crisps even more. (Cookin’ with Mima)
  • Rack Method: For extra crispiness, try roasting the potatoes on a wire rack on top of the baking sheet — allows hot air to circulate. (Epicurious)
  • Gremolata Twist: Add a fresh gremolata (parsley + lemon zest + garlic) as a garnish for a bright flavor. (Natalie Cooks)
  • Herb Variations: Use smoked paprika, rosemary, or chili flakes for different flavor profiles. (Hungry Huy)
  • Air Fryer Option: You can also make them in an air fryer by tossing the potatoes in oil + cheese + seasonings, then air frying at ~200°C / 400°F until crisp. (Some users do this.) (Dishing Delish)
